In order to simplify m-c code, move some in pdf.js
* move set/clear|Timeout/Interval and crackURL code in pdf.js * remove the "backdoor" in the proxy (used to dispatch event) and so return the dispatch function in the initializer * remove listeners if an error occured during sandbox initialization * add support for alert and prompt in the sandbox * add a function to eval in the global scope
